Botanical Green Peace on Earth

Botanical Green Peace on Earth

  • $253.95
    Unit price per 
Shipping calculated at checkout.

Only 1 left!

LauraLove Designs LL-PW-5B, 13 mesh, 12 x 12

We Also Recommend